Ecological measures for detecting emotions Devices potentially usable for detecting emotions should, especially in a learning context, not be invasive . For the purpose of an ecological and non-invasive context-aware measurement, we hypothesize to measure internal physiological signals through an electronic bracelet or a smartwatch while, external parameters, through a camera and a screen-based eye tracker. The objective of this part of the system is to identify emotional indices through measurement sensors , in order to understand which part of the interaction is most critical for that specific student.

For example, if while reading the third line a subject frowns and his heartbeat slows down, it means that he has communicated a certain feeling in parallel with the task in progress. The following figure provides an example of detection of the electrical signal relating to the galvanic response of the skin during the administration of triggers introduced by the experimenter : as can be seen, the conductance peaks coincide with the administration of the trigger.

Positive affective computing and dyslexia Here, I will limit myself to describing the internal and external physiological signals that can be measured through the use of the devices indicated above. I therefore exclude the large amount of work done in the field of EEG-based affective state recognition due to the practical limitations of EEG in real-life scenarios, while recognizing its fundamental role in the history of neuroscience. Internal physiological signals Wearable emotion recognition uses changes in physiology to identify correlates of emotions . Numerous studies have been conducted in the area of emotion recognition using physiological signals. Emotion recognition based on physiological signals is applied in many areas such as road safety, health and social well-being.
